The National Health Service of United Kingdom is taken into consideration tohave a view over the impact of positive behaviour of medication in social care sector and topromote the same.P1 Current legislation and policies regarding handling of medicationTo heal the patient, it is important to aid them with appropriate medication. For this,various rules and regulations are framed by the government. Some of them are given below:The Controlled Drugs Regulations 2013: To use and manage the drugs in a controlledway, this is introduced by the government. For modern social sectors, this is of utmostimportant and hence, NHS has also implemented this policy.The Misuse of Drugs Act 2001: This came into existence to have a lawful and controlleddrug supply. It includes all the factors which help to prevent the drug misuse, likeprescribing, record keeping, proper disposal, etc.Many other regulations are also there (Sin and et.al., 2015). For example, Medicines Act 1968,the Health Act 2006, etc. All these help to support the positive behaviour of medication in socialcare setting.P2 Roles and responsibilities of the person involved in supporting the use of medicationTo assist in the medication, the practitioners, support workers, nurses and pharmacistsplay a vital role. They have several responsibilities upon them to treat the patients in a betterway. Some of them are listed below:They have to understand the rules and regulations for proper medication.They have to assist the patients or the relatives while opening the bottles of medicineslike, in removing lids if they are not able to do so.They have to take proper care of the patients by asking them at regular interval about theintake of drugs (Sahay and et.al., 2015).They have to give them remedial measures if a particular medicine is not suiting them.They must have the proper knowledge of side-effects and contra indications.Workers should be familiar with the complete history of the patients.They should know the techniques to administer the medication.
